Personalized Biomarker Analysis involves the detailed interpretation of an individual’s unique array of measurable biological indicators—hormones, metabolites, inflammatory markers, and genetic variants—to construct a highly specific health profile. This analysis moves beyond population averages to define an optimal functional range unique to that person’s physiology. It is the foundation of precision medicine in wellness science.
Origin
This analytical approach is a direct descendant of genomic science and advanced clinical chemistry, leveraging high-throughput assays to generate vast datasets for individual interpretation. The personalization aspect acknowledges that biological variance necessitates tailored reference intervals. It shifts the focus from diagnosing disease to optimizing function.
Mechanism
The mechanism functions by integrating data from diverse sources, such as saliva cortisol rhythms, serum sex hormone ratios, and micronutrient levels, often employing sophisticated software algorithms. This integration reveals subtle patterns of dysregulation in axes like the HPA or HPT that standard testing might miss. The analysis then directly informs the precise dosing and combination of therapeutic modalities required for that individual.
